Lions running back Reggie Bush’s knee injury is not severe. But it is serious enough that he’s planning to sit on the bench today in Washington.

We noted on Friday that the Lions were thinking of holding Bush out as a precaution, and Adam Schefter of ESPN reported this morning that that’s exactly what the Lions are planning to do today: Bush is expected to sit.

That’s a big blow for the Lions’ offense because Bush has looked sensational for the game and a half that he’s been healthy. But if this makes Bush more healthy for the long run, it’s the right move. In fact, the Lions made a big mistake when they didn’t play it safe with Bush last week: After he got hurt and left the game against the Cardinals, he returned for one play -- on which he looked awkward taking a handoff and promptly fumbled.

With Bush out, Joique Bell will be the Lions’ primary running back, while backups Mikel Leshoure and Theo Riddick may get their first carries of the season.
